New AT&T Users Appear Excited Throughout United States.New York-Much of the hype and mania that surrounded the release of the iPhone a year ago appears to be repeating itself in the United States as the countdown to the new Apple 3G iPhone release gets closer.

The newer iPhone that is slated to make its appearance on Friday will have a wider release than the iPhone that was released a year ago, and this may be quelling a lot of the overall mania that affected the Apple iPhone release that occurred about a year ago.

The new process of activation may slow a lot of the iPhone buzz, the customers that will make up the first wave of new United States iPhone users may face long slow moving lines as they face activation of their new phone.

The new phone will have a $199 dollar price tag, and is expected to reach a wider audience this year than the release last year had.

Starting at 8am on Friday, July 11th, 2008, customers will be able to purchase the new iPhone in the United States.

Lines are likely to be long, especially at first, but Apple and AT&T are expecting the supply to be more than adequate for the demand.
